Rubyは、日本人の松本行弘によって開発されたオブジェクト指向スクリプト言語です。シンプルで直感的な構文が特徴で、生産性と開発者の幸福を重視しています。Webアプリケーションフレームワーク「Ruby on Rails」で広く知られ、迅速なプロトタイピングとスケーラブルなアプリケーション開発に適しています。
Rubyを学ぶメリットは、そのシンプルで直感的な構文により、プログラミングの学習が容易になることです。特に「Ruby on Rails」を使ったWebアプリケーション開発で生産性が高く、迅速にプロトタイプを作成できます。また、活発なコミュニティと豊富なリソースがサポートを提供し、スキルの向上とキャリアの機会を広げます。Rubyを学ぶためのおすすめ本12選を紹介します。
- ゼロからわかる Ruby 超入門 (かんたんIT基礎講座)
- 3ステップでしっかり学ぶ Ruby入門
- RubyでつくるRuby ゼロから学びなおすプログラミング言語入門
- たのしいRuby 第6版 (Informatics&IDEA)
- プロを目指す人のためのRuby入門[改訂2版] 言語仕様からテスト駆動開発・デバッグ技法まで
- アジャイル時代のオブジェクト脳のつくり方: Rubyで学ぶ究極の基礎講座
- 独習Ruby 新版
- RubyではじめるWebアプリの作り方
- 改訂2版 Ruby逆引きハンドブック
- Effective Ruby: あなたのRubyをより輝かせる48の特別な方法
- 改訂2版 パーフェクトRuby
- 研鑽Rubyプログラミング 実践的なコードのための原則とトレードオフ
- まとめ